Harkishanpura
Harkishanpura is a village in Maur, Bathinda, Punjab. Harkishanpura is situated nearby to the village Kotra, as well as near Gehri Bara Singh.Places in the Area

Kot Fatta
Town
Kot Fatta is a city and a municipal council in Bathinda district in the Indian state of Punjab. The town is the second railway station on the Bathinda–Delhi railway line. Kot Fatta is situated 9 km west of Harkishanpura.
